Samson Gash's Commitment to Michigan State

Samson Gash, a highly-touted four-star wide receiver from Novi, Michigan, has officially committed to the Michigan State Spartans. This signing marks a significant achievement for the university's football program, as Gash is considered their highest-rated recruit. His decision came on National Signing Day, solidifying his verbal commitment made last summer. Gash's enrollment is a testament to the new coaching staff's efforts, as he had initially delayed his signing to assess the team's new leadership before making his final choice. His commitment was highly sought after, with strong pushes from other collegiate powerhouses like Penn State, Georgia, and West Virginia, all of whom Gash ultimately chose to bypass in favor of Michigan State.

The addition of Samson Gash to the Michigan State football roster is a monumental victory for the program and particularly for new head coach Pat Fitzgerald. Gash's impressive recruiting profile, which includes a 90.80 rating in 247Sports' composite system, positions him as the No. 43 wide receiver nationally, the No. 6 player from Michigan, and the No. 283 overall prospect in the 2026 class. His status as the top prospect in Michigan State's 2026 class, according to 247Sports, underscores the importance of retaining his commitment.
